Rental Market Trends

Daphne, AL

As of August 2025, Daphne's rental market is stable, offering a predictable rental market where most units lease within a few weeks. Daphne's average rent is 61.0% ($735) higher than the Alabama average of $1,204 and 8.3% ($149) higher than the U.S. average of $1,790.

Daphne Rental Market FAQs

Explore rental prices, market trends, and availability in Daphne, AL.

The average rent in Daphne, AL is $1,939 per month.
Homes in Daphne typically rent for between $909 and $2,543 per month, with an average of $1,939 per month.
In Daphne, the average rent for a 1-bedroom home is $1,299 per month, for a 2-bedroom home, $1,559 per month, and a 3-bedroom home is $1,956 per month.
The average rent in Daphne is 8.3% ($149) higher than the national average of $1,790 per month.
The average rent in Daphne has decreased by 0.8% ($15) in the last month and increased by 6.1% ($112) over the past year.
The rental market in Daphne, AL, is currently stable, offering a predictable rental market where most units lease within a few weeks.
In Daphne, AL, the average rental stays on the market for approximately 42 days. While most properties are rented within this timeframe, factors like seasonality, demand, and property type can affect how quickly a rental leases.
There are currently 22 rental properties available in Daphne, AL.
Based on the current averages, a household would need an annual income of $62,360 to comfortably afford a 2-bedroom home in Daphne.
